Replacing A Carpet Patch For Home Owners

If you have a badly damaged section of carpet such as a cigarette burn or bleach spot what are you to do. One option is to replace that area with a patch. Read this article to learn about how to replace a small damaged section of your carpet.

Sometimes the only way to fix a spot in a carpet is to cut it out and replace it. This is true with things like cigarette burns which can burn all the way down to the backing. If you would like to repair this yourself you will need a few things. First you will need a carpet repair tool which is available at most carpet supply stores. It only costs a few dollars and it is a round cutting tool that will allow you to make a precise cut in the carpet. You will also need some adhesive disks and carpet clue.

SteamVac Cleaner

To begin you will find a donor carpet, usually a hidden section of the carpet or an extra piece of carpet you have handy. Now take your cutting tool and cut out the damaged section. Be careful to not cut through the carpet fibers themselves. Next cut a replacement section from the donor carpet also being careful not to cut the carpet fibers. Next you will peel off the cover on the adhesive disk and place it in the empty hole. Now put some glue around the edge of the hole and insert your patch trying to match the grain of the carpet. (Carpet has a distinct grain). Press the patch firmly into place and put a weight on top of the area. Let it dry at least twenty four hours before putting the carpet to use.

Are you still interest in a Trans Am for sale? All right then, there are several things you should know about these fabled F-bodies before taking the plunge in order to maximize this investment. Let's focus on the Trans Ams sold between 1971 and 1981 because these are the most popular models with enthusiasts. The key here is to not get overly excited, and buy the first Trans Am you come across. Be patient, and be selective. Consider your mechanical skills, and be willing to pay more in order to limit the big jobs.

Like all older cars, the Firebird is prone to rust, and this should be an area of focus for all potential buyers. The rear frame rails and the rear axle kick-up are particularly fragile. Pay particular attention to the leaf spring connections and the box supports. The trunk floor is also another problem area especially if the car was in a cold or salty climate. It's common to find Firebirds with the trunk completely rotted out. The gas tank, the lower quarter panels, and rear fender splats were also quite prone to holding mud and salt.

Is rust a deal breaker? How much bodywork are you willing to take on? These are important considerations because any Trans Am for sale that doesn't have a five-digit price tag is going to involve some rust, and this type of bodywork is not a simple process, especially for the uninitiated.

Keep in mind that by the time you see rust, the body is in bad shape. Perform a thorough inspection. Don't assume that just because you don't see it, it isn't there. When we find a Trans Am with rust, it's common to see crude repairs performed with Bondo. This is your cue to walk away from the purchase unless you are very skilled with bodywork. This type of prepare may work in one sense, but it makes it dramatically more difficult to get the body up to car show caliber.

As mentioned earlier, the key to this process is patience. With enough of it, you will find that Trans Am for sale in the right condition at the right price. If you're working on a tight budget, then stick to the private sellers where you'll have more room to negotiate. You'll have more options through the auctions and dealers but a lot less flexibility.

The Short Sale Process - Understanding the Short Sale Process

When housing prices in many parts of the country were booming a couple of years ago, there wasn't much national attention given to short sales. But with the current subprime debacle and increasing mortgage delinquencies, many people are wondering if the short sale process is a way to avoid foreclosure.

Basically, the definition of the short sale process is when the lender of a property allows the property to be sold for less than the amount due on the mortgage loan.

Sale

The obvious benefit to the short sale process is that it allows the seller to avoid the credit report damage associated with a foreclosure. A foreclosure can stay on your credit report for up to 10 years and can take an emotional and financial toll on you and your family.

The Short Sale Process - Understanding the Short Sale Process

But the pitfalls of the short sale process should be considered as well. The I.R.S. may consider any debt forgiveness as taxable income, thus resulting in a tax liability. In addition, lenders can often pursue a borrower for the deficiency balance (the difference between the amount owed and the amount paid).

In some cases you may be able to avoid taxation if you can prove you are insolvent. But if insolvency is unsuccessful, and you are faced with a tax liability resulting from the deficiency amount, it may make more financial sense for you to let the lender foreclose.

The Short Sale Process

The short sale process can vary, but it will generally work as follows:

1) The lender is contacted to discuss the possibility of a short sale and to determine the lender's process for completing the sale.

2) The seller issues a letter authorizing the release of personal information about the loan and the property to the buyer or escrow agency.

3) The lender will review a settlement statement, which will indicate the proposed selling price, remaining loan balances and itemize all expenses, including real estate commissions and other fees and expenses associated with the closing.

4) The seller will complete a "hardship letter," which will detail and explain all financial difficulties. Lenders will usually want to validate the seller's financial situation by looking at bank statements, investment accounts, along with examining paystubs and other financial records.

5) The lender will then look to the broker to provide a price opinion by examining the condition of the house and the market value of comparable properties.

6) The lender will then want to scrutinize the purchase agreement to determine if all amounts are reasonable and the real estate commission is acceptable.

Because of the documentation required, the short sale process can be lengthy. But if done correctly, it can work well for all parties involved. The lender avoids the uncertainty of the foreclosure process, the seller avoids a foreclosure on his or her credit report (along with potential bankruptcy), and the buyer hopefully got a good deal on a property.

Considering the complexity of the short sale process, you must be educated. If you are considering a short sale, make sure that you discuss your situation with a competent lawyer and accountant. The more educated you are on the process, the easier the transaction will be, and the better the impression you will make on the lender.

Used Cars For Sale On EBay

There are thousands of used cars for sale on eBay every
single day. In fact, eBay Motors is the most profitable
sales division on eBay and naturally there are many
entrepreneurs who are interested in jumping into this
market. For instance, eBay claims it sells an SUV every nine
seconds and is the biggest online car dealer in America,
exceeding the traditional car companies. In fact, there are
15 million cars sold over the Internet each year - and
growing.

The recent rapid growth of the consignment business model
has made the used car market even more enticing. Many
sellers are able to sell cars they have never even seen and
with no more risk than the cost of the auction listing. Some
negotiators even persuade the car owner to pay for the ad,
thereby risking no more than their time.

Sale

The biggest single issue for this business model is the
trust of prospective buyers. After all, paying thousands or
tens of thousands of dollars for a car sight unseen is an
awesome leap of faith. Even buying for a plane ticket to go
see a car before paying causes buyers to be uncomfortable.

Used Cars For Sale On EBay

The best way sellers can overcome this fear is to use an
escrow service. eBay has a preferred service, and it's
easiest to use that one.

An escrow service acts as a neutral third party. In an
exchange of merchandise, the buyer sends his money to the
escrow service and the seller ships the product to the
buyer. The buyer usually has two days to inspect his
purchase, and if he is happy, he notifies the escrow company
who releases the money to the seller, minus its fee. If the
buyer is dissatisfied, he returns the undamaged merchandise
to the seller, and after the seller receives his merchandise
back (in satisfactory condition), the escrow service returns
the buyer's money. Thus both sides in the transaction are
protected. The buyer almost always pays the fees for this,
although sometimes buyer and seller split the cost.

eBay's offers a "Vehicle Services Division" specifically for
dealing with the used cars, trucks, SUVs and almost anything
else with wheels and a motor. The buyer can request a 160
point inspection performed before agreeing to the purchase.
This is an inexpensive service and certainly will save the
purchaser many headaches.

* The buyer pays a 5 fee that is non-refundable

* The seller is contacted and the inspection is carried outv
* The buyer receives a reportv
* The buyer chooses to go ahead with the purchase - or not

Another choice for the buyer is to deposit his payment with
the escrow service and then take delivery of the vehicle.
The seller ships the car after he knows the money his
secure. The seller must provide tracking information, which
is then verified.

The buyer has between one and 30 days to thoroughly inspect
his new purchase (the period is negotiated between the two
parties ahead of time). If this time expires and the escrow
company has not heard from the buyer, it assumes he is happy
and gives the purchase price to the seller.

The buyer may return his vehicle if he isn't happy and
sometimes buyers and sellers work out partial payment
agreements, the buyer being satisfied with some parts of the
transaction, but not with others. If a dispute arises, it is
settled by the American Arbitration Association.

The fee for this service is:

* - ,500 = value of vehicle: 5

* ,500.01 to ,000: 0

* ,000.01 to ,000: 0

* ,000.01 to ,000: 5

* ,000+ = 6% of the value

Once both parties have agreed, the title transfer process
begins and the escrow service will guarantee this too, for a
fee of . The fee, naturally, doesn't include any transfer
costs - it is only insurance that the title will be
expedited to the satisfaction of both parties.

eBay's escrow service also offers a service that will ship
cars almost anywhere in the world and will gather an auto
history report to inform sellers if their new chariot has
been salvaged or stolen, suffered flood or hail damage, been
in a fire or accident, has had an odometer rollback or has
been used as a police car, a rental or a taxi.

Anyone considering offering used cars for sale on eBay would
be well advised to thoroughly learn the escrow services
available and offer those to prospective buyers. The trust
factor will skyrocket and your chances of completing sales
will dramatically increase.

Accident Damaged Cars For Sale

Accident Damaged Cars are one of the most common type of salvage vehicles available on the open market. These accident damaged cars are usually vehicles that have been taken over by insurance companies for reasons of not having to pay auto body companies from repairing damage that would cost more than the vehicle itself. The insurance companies would rather pay the owner the value of the vehicle that may be considerably less than having the vehicle repaired.

Once the car has been taken by the insurance company it is usually priced out to junk or salvage dealers who tend to either strip the cars and sell the parts or if the car is not damaged to far resale it to the public. Once the accident damaged car for sale is sold it still has a long way to go before it is able to be driven on the open road. When sold these vehicles are deemed un-drivable by motor vehicle associations. The vehicles need to go through the process of being repaired and brought back up to standards that each country deems necessary.

Sale

Now the repairs are done and you feel that the repairs are all that you need. Well, the vehicle is still not ready for the open road. Meaning, you still will not be able to register the vehicle just yet. Now, you need to have the car inspected. You don't want to drive around a car that is unsafe. I know that I would not. The inspection should be done by an authorized inspection station of the state. This inspection station will tell you if the repairs are up to par. If the repairs are not then they will recommend what repairs are still needed and which are not. If no repairs are not needed then they will give you passing paper work that you take with you to a registration station. If their are still problems that have to be taken care of either the inspection station will take care of it or you will need to take it back to the place were you had the initial work done. Once completed go back and have a final inspection done. Now you are ready for registration.

Accident Damaged Cars For Sale

Accident damaged cars for sale are great deals but you really need to know the process when bringing these cars back to life.

One Way to Dye Your Own Carpets

The tan carpet in #216 was shot.

It was hopeless.

SteamVac Cleaner

A new carpet was needed.

One Way to Dye Your Own Carpets

That meant pulling up the old one, scraping off the pad, and then calling the carpet man and shelling out 00 or more.

It wasn't anyone's fault.

The carpet had served well.

But, upon closer examination, I decided it wasn't really in that bad of shape.

It didn't have frayed edges, or worn down spots, and the nap was still pretty good. It just looked terrible. Bleach spots, stains, dark trails down the hallway and into the living room, and light spots where the sun had hit it on a daily basis through the windows.

No one would rent the apartment with a carpet in that condition.

I steam cleaned it in hopes that it would be miraculously healed.

No such luck.

Then it hit me.

Why not try dyeing the bleached out spots to blend in with the carpet.

I purchased an 8 ounce bottle of RIT tan dye (the kind you use for dyeing clothes) at the drug store for , mixed a little in a spray bottle with steaming hot water, shook it up and sprayed the spots.

They came out a brassy brown, nothing like the color of the existing carpet.

I had the carpet professionally steam cleaned. Surely they could perform a miracle.

Nope.

But I noticed that my dyeing job over the bleached out spots had maintained its original color.

Then it occurred to me, why not try dyeing the entire carpet to match the spots I had sprayed?

Two pictures came to mind on how I might do this.

I could mix the dye with hot water in my little steam cleaner (one like you would rent at the market) or I could use a pump up garden sprayer. I decided on the sprayer because the tenant below had suffered through enough steam cleaning noise.

I purchased an ACE Sprayer for .

I mixed 8 tablespoons of dye into the 2 quarts of steaming hot water in the sprayer, screwed in the pump, shook up the contents and pumped it up.

I placed four 1"x 6" x 3' pieces of wood along the edges of the walls so as not to get dye on the white paint. I adjusted the nozzle on the sprayer to a fine spray and began.

I moved the boards as I dyed, but after a while as I became familiar with the sprayer, I didn't really need them.

Also, after dyeing a section, and before reloading the sprayer, I used my little Bissell carpet sweeper to even out the areas I had sprayed and work the dye into the carpet.

But still, the bleached out spots didn't match the overall carpet color after I finished dyeing.

So the next day I applied another coat.

Better, but still not good enough.

Then I went back to the store for more dye, but they didn't have anymore tan. I went to three other stores, but no tan.

So, I bought RIT's dark brown dye.

This turned out to be a blessing in disguise.

I put 4 tablespoons of this darker dye into my 2 quarts of steaming hot water, pumped up the sprayer and applied another coat.

That's when the magic began to happen.

The darker brown really kicked in.

The trails down the hallway disappeared, as did the light spots under the windows.

The carpet started to look like a real carpet again, but the bleached out spots still dyed a slightly darker shade than the rest of the carpet.

To compensate for this I dyed other parts of the carpet darker by spraying more dye on them, and continued using my carpet sweeper to even out the dye and work it into the nap. My goal was to blend everything together.

It worked... somewhat.

I applied two coats of the dark brown dye, about worth of dye, over a 700 square foot area.

It was easy, and fun to do.

By the time I applied the second coat the carpet looked almost new.

Because I've obsessed over the bleached out stains in the carpet I can still find some of them, but not all. There is a slight darkening in the carpet where they once existed, but when a potential tenant came through to rent the apartment, and I explained to her what I had done, she glanced at it, said it looked fine, and went to look at the kitchen.

My daughter and my neighbor also viewed the carpet and both stated it looked great, better than their own carpets.

But I know it's not perfect. It went from a D- or F to a C+/ B- or maybe even a B, and those grades really depend on what angle you look at the carpet from.

My father mentioned that the dye might be toxic.

I hadn't thought of that. I figured if you could dye your clothes with it you could certainly do a carpet.

But to be safe I called RIT, the makers of the dye, and their representative assured me that all their dyes are non-toxic, but that they don't recommend using them on carpets because some of their customers have called and said the dye rubs off over time.

I went back up to #216, soaked a rag with steaming hot water, and tried to rub off the dye in several spots.

Nothing happened.

Maybe in time the dye will wear off in well traveled areas.

I'm not sure.

Time will tell.

But if it does wear off, and the carpet is still usable, why not dye those areas again, like repainting walls, or staining wood doors and trim that experience wear and tear?

P.S. My daughter suggested that I include this following idea: Why not cut out a stencil of your favorite design, say a star or elephant, place it over the stain or bleached out spot, and then spray the dye into the stencil. A lot easier than dyeing the entire carpet!

Just a thought.

Homes for Sale By Owner Land Contract Michigan

The homes for sale by owner land contract Michigan residents are able to provide to interested parties a home at an affordable price. A land contract in Michigan is often beneficial for both parties, when conducted in the correct manner.

There are a number of instances in which reputable and reliable individuals in Michigan will find themselves in financial trouble and facing a possible foreclosure on their home or land. Instead of succumbing to this problem, it is important that these individuals realize that hope does not need to be lost in these unfortunate situations.

Sale

Even in these troubling times, there are alternatives available to these people aside from the foreclosure on their property. A land contract in Michigan can be just the thing to help these people, or anyone that is looking to sell their property quickly and without involving a mortgage company.

Homes for Sale By Owner Land Contract Michigan

As a contract between the owner of the property in the state of Michigan and the buyer or purchaser of the aforementioned property, a land contract in Michigan allows the transaction to take place for a pre-determined and specified monetary amount, in exchange for the rights to the land or home. The purchaser agrees to make the decided upon payments for the property over time to the seller, who is required to hand over the physical manifestation of the deed to the property owner or purchaser when the entirety of the land contract has been paid in full.

The laws surrounding the homes for sale by owner land contract Michigan residents must adhere to are outlined in a very clear way in these instances. Possession and living rights, for all intents and purposes, are immediately available to the purchasers of the many available homes for sale by owner land contract Michigan residents have to offer. In the end, it is the title that is not turned over to the purchasers until the payments have all been made. This is what allows the sellers to maintain some collateral when they are in the process of selling their properties. Homes for sale by owner land contract Michigan laws are able to protect sellers in this way.

However, land contracts are also beneficial for interested buyers as well. For example, buyers who want to own a home but have poor or damaged credit can often work with sellers on terms. Investors, like us here, can also help educate buyers on ways to repair their credit and get them the financing they need.

Sometimes bad things happen to good people and someone who can make monthly payments and has some money to put down on a home should be able to buy one, even if the bank isn't willing to give out a loan.

he sale of the home in this specific type of contractual agreement , therefore, is able to help all involved parties. Despite the many benefits, there are a number of states that have, over the years, presented a number of problems when it comes to making the ownership of a property easy in the form of a land contract.

Homes for Sale By Owner Land Contract Michigan

However, a land contract in Michigan is a valid form of property transaction. Homes for sale by owner via land contract in Michigan bring supply to the market as options for potential buyers who would otherwise not be able to buy a home.

As long as the seller is motivated and willing to work on terms and the buyer has stable income to make monthly payments and has a bit of money for a downpayment, a win/win situation can often be structured.

The Difference Between Steam Carpet Cleaners and Rug Shampooers

What's the difference in these appliances? Carpet cleaner. Rug shampooer. Carpet extractor. Carpet steamer. Carpet steam cleaner. And Steam carpet cleaner. Say to yourself...there is no difference. There is no difference. All these names refer to the same appliance. An appliance that cleans your carpet in pretty much the same fashion as other appliances with the similar name. Don't be confused by this piece of information.

Although you may see the name "steam" in the description, all these carpet cleaning appliance do NOT use steam for cleaning. They use uses hot water and occasionally chemical solutions pushed into your carpet, then extracted with a powerful vacuum. You can find a piece of equipment known as a steam cleaner, but its normally not the piece of equipment you use at home or on your carpet. Steam cleaners are used on engines, and occasionally on carpet spots where the carpet can handle the intense heat. Carpets that can handle the heat are usually commercial type installations.

SteamVac Cleaner

There is a difference between a vacuum cleaners and a steam carpet cleaner. Vacuums use an air pump to suck dirt and dust from carpets. Carpet cleaners do more. After injecting inject a cleaning solution into your rug, they stir it up trying to loosen all the dirt, then extract the fluid and the dirt. When you are planning to clean your carpet, its a good idea to use "green" chemicals in your cleaning. No matter how good the cleaner is, some residue can get left behind. If you have young children or pets, green is good.

The Difference Between Steam Carpet Cleaners and Rug Shampooers

Here are key features of the so called steam carpet cleaners.

Water temperature. Some units have heating elements, or you bring the hot water yourself by pouring it into the machine. All home carpet cleaners clean the same basic way. Hot water, injected into the carpet, then pulled back out to leave the surface, and slightly below the surface cleaner. The heat of the water is one of the most critical features in getting your carpets clean. One difference in these machines, smaller units with only one element don't get as hot or as quickly as the larger units.

You'll want separate solution and recovery tanks. The bigger these tanks are, the stopping and starting you'll do as you work on your rug. The recovery tank contains the dirt pulled from your carpet.

The less water on your carpet the better. Water is pretty much an enemy of carpet. You'll want a cleaner that uses low flow technology. You'll get less water in your carpet and be able to put the room back to use in the shortest time. Another advantage of less water in your carpet is less chance for mold or mildew and less damage to your carpet.

Certain steam carpet cleaners have a feature called temperature control. As we learned earlier, the higher temps mean better cleaning. However, there are delicate carpets that cannot handle heat or high temperatures. If you have a machine with the ability of your machine to control the water temperature helps you be more flexible.

Rigorous vacuuming alone won't keep your carpets clean, but it is a good start. Regular vacuuming is effective to eliminate surface and dust particles. However, vacuuming won't eliminate stubborn stains, dirt, and grime on the carpet surface, fibers, or base. Carpet manufacturers recommended cleaning your carpet every 12 to 18 months. No matter how you describe what you are doing to your carpet, you're using the same product. Steam carpet cleaners, carpet steam cleaners, rug shampooers, carpet cleaners, carpet steamers, or carpet extractors. Your home will be healthier and cleaner, and you'll know exactly the appliance you need to get the job done.

White Coating on Tongue and Bad Breath (Halitosis)

Stare at yourself in the mirror and bring your tongue out - do you have a white coating on your tongue and bad breath? A lot of people who experience bad breath (halitosis) have a noticeable white coating at the end of the tongue. Even if you don't notice anything, you might have a coating, at times referred to as a biofilm, on your tongue formed by countless unusual microbes, the leftovers of food and body cells, and a non-cellular medium that holds it in unison.

A number of microbes living on your tongue are most probably pathogens - organisms that can cause infectivity and bad breath, actually, the tongue is the habitat of the maximum number of microbes living in the mouth. This is why it is so advantageous to employ a tongue cleaner to eliminate the biofilm, mainly if you have a noticeably coated tongue and bad breath. Studies have revealed that habitual physical elimination of the coating brings about a noteworthy decrease in numbers of pathogenic bacteria in the mouth, and in the amount of halitosis.

Physical tongue cleaning will be more successful against your bad breath, coated tongue and oral microbes as the noncellular medium of the biofilm in fact shields the organisms in it from mouthwashes, normal immune cells and the cleaning act of saliva - imagine of a rigid jelly-like material putting everything in a thin water-resistant layer. An excellent tongue cleaner or tongue scraper gets past the barrier of the medium by simply scraping it all away and lessening the coated tongue and bad breath. In the meantime, lower layers that turn out to be uncovered will be susceptible to antibacterial substances in the mouth like saliva or mouthwash at the same time as the biofilm is reestablishing itself.

And it will restore itself - no tongue cleaner or antibacterial product will ever totally eliminate the unwelcome organisms in your mouth that are producing bad breath coated tongue and even gum disease. It is achievable, though to maintain the numbers of these organisms down with a usual program of superior oral cleanliness together with tongue scraping and the application of a mouthwash that aims to remove the bacteria that forms heavily coated tongue and bad breath.

There are quite a lot of potentials for what causes a white coating on the tongue. The most well known reason of a white coating is a candidal infection, which is caused by fungus. Moreover, thrush can be formed by antibiotics or steroids that were breathed in for sinus or asthma problems. In addition, a white coating can just be the increase of dead cells on the tongue.

o A white coating on the tongue may be formed due to dehydration! If you aren't drinking a sufficient amount of water, it is quite probable that tiny pieces of food are sticking with your tongue! Just drinking more and more water will cure this situation. Therefore, drinking large amount of water assists you very much when it comes to a white coating of the tongue.

o To prevent white coating of your tongue you should avoid soy milk which is definitely one of its root causes.

o Clean your tongue with a tongue scraper. Be certain that you have cleaned the end position of your tongue where in most of the cases microbes survive. Be cautious and don't rub too hard the initial time.

o Make an effort to brush your tongue with a combination of baking soda, 3% hydrogen peroxide and water. Don't try it for a long time; otherwise your tongue might get raw.

o Add 1/8 teaspoon of cayenne pepper to lukewarm water and allow the combination to sit in your mouth for as much time as you can control. The cayenne pepper appears to draw mucous up and out. It's an excellent treatment for sore throats also.

o Initially, place 1 spoon of salt in a cup after that add water, then immerse your tooth brush into it and brush your tongue, it might hurt although then the pain and white coating will disappear. Or hold the salty water for approximately half a minute on your tongue and then gargle for another half minute then spit out.
